2. Resilient Frame
The frame of the sofa is vital to its sturdiness and convenience, so you should search for one that's constructed to last. A wood or solid steel frame will be more powerful and less vulnerable to snapping or cracking. You also wish to ensure the frame is kiln-dried, that makes it more resistant to humidity. Also, if the couch is upholstered with fabric, you'll wish to choose a material that's strong and resilient, such as polyester or microfiber.

Before you buy any sofa, walk the length of the course it will take a trip through your home-- from the front door to its last area. This will help you make sure that the couch will fit through the doors, stairwells, and turning radius you'll come across, particularly if it has to go up or down stairs.
